    At close to midnight on a long-forgotten February night, the guards brought out the cut, bruised and guilty man for one final piece of ridicule in front of a frothing crowd.

    The poor American, holding an ice pack to a swollen cheek, had no chance as he was ushered into a seat to face one final inquisition.

    I was in Mexico City in the filthy bowels of the majestic Azteca Stadium on a crisp night in 1993 and Greg Haugen, the American, was not a captive, just a beaten and * boxer.

    "This American dog had no chance to beat me," said Julio Cesar Chavez to roars and hoots from the 300 people at the post-fight press conference.
